Kickstarter is an American crowdfunding platform founded in 2008 in San Francisco. It allows users to raise money for creative projects or start-up businesses. It charges a 5% fee on successful contributions in addition to credit card processing fees. Fifteen million people visit the site each month. The founders were inspired to create an alternative funding source after having difficulties funding creative projects. Kickstarter allows users to create pages for funding campaigns with perks for different contribution levels and then promote their projects on social media.
